The MAX4211AEUE is an operational amplifier designed for amplifying low-level signals with high accuracy. It utilizes a differential input stage followed by a gain stage and an output buffer. The differential input stage provides high common-mode rejection ratio (CMRR) and rejects common-mode noise. The gain stage amplifies the differential signal, while the output buffer provides a low impedance drive to the load. The amplifier operates on a wide range of supply voltages and offers rail-to-rail input and output capability.
